中棉紫光公司的“全程低温分步萃取脱酚工艺”首次实现了棉籽脱酚的规模化, 目前在国内建有 40 余条生产线,年设计加工能力 200 余万吨光棉籽,超过全国棉籽 产量的 20%。近几年由于行情低迷,我国脱酚棉籽蛋白加工企业盈利水平大幅下降, 很多企业面临着严峻的生存危机。为给我国棉籽深加工企业探索一个稳定有效的、市 场前景广阔的发展方向,本课题对在棉籽脱酚生产线基础上进一步拓展生产线生产新 型发酵培养基氮源——棉籽精粉的项目进行可行性分析。 为增强课题研究实用性和针对性,为棉籽脱酚企业起到现实指导作用,选择一棉 籽蛋白厂作为例子,以此公司的现实情况为基础,对现有设备设施进行适当调整并建 设棉籽精粉生产线。根据可行性研究的要求,对项目建设的必要性、技术的可行性、 经济的合理性进行分析,并研究投资效果、社会效益和经济效益,形成一套完整的可 行性分析报告。 本项目的产品棉籽精粉将为生物发酵产业提供一种新的优质培养基氮源,提升我 国培养基氮源品质,打破国内生物发酵企业对国外高品质有机氮源的高度依赖性。项 目符合国家产业政策,具有良好的社会效益;财务指标优异,经济效益良好,具备财 务可行性;本项目是可行的、必要的。 关键词,棉籽深加工;脱酚;脱酚棉籽蛋白;发酵;培养基;氮源;棉籽精粉II Abstract The patented “entire process low temperature two-step solvent Extracted” technology by China Cotton Unis-BioScience Co., Ltd., scaled up the cottonseed degossypolize processing industry for the first time. By now, more than 40 production lines have been built in domestic, total processing capacity more than 2 million tons of cottonseed annually, about 20% of the national cottonseed production. In recent years due to the downturn in the market, profitability of the degossypolized cottonseed meal (DCM) processing enterprises fell sharply, many enterprises face the serious survival crisis. In order to explore a stable and effective development direction with wide market prospects to the cottonseed deep processing enterprises, this topic will carry out the feasibility analysis of new-built project “using DCM as raw material to produce cottonseed powder, a new type fermentation medium nitrogen source”. To enhance the practicability and pertinence of the research, choosing a DCM factory for example, based on the company’s present situation, modify the existing equipment and facilities, and build a new production line of cottonseed powder. According to the requirements of the feasibility study, analyzing the necessity of the project’s construction, the feasibility of the technology and the economical rationality, researching the investment effect, social benefit and economic benefit, to form a complete set of feasibility study report. The production of this project, cottonseed powder, will help domestic biological fermentation enterprises getting rid of the highly dependence of foreign biological fermentation nitrogen source, and expanding the space for development.This project conforms to national industrial policy, has good social efficiency and excellent financial index, has the financial feasibility; so this project is feasible and necessary.
